US govt appeals judge’s ruling that blocked ban on TikTok downloads – Software

The US government mentioned in a court docket submitting on Thursday it was pleasing a judge’s ruling that prevented it from prohibiting new downloads of the Chinese-owned limited online video-sharing application TikTok.

The Justice Section mentioned it appealed the order to the US Court docket of Appeals for the DC Circuit.

In late September, a US decide temporarily blocked a Trump administration order that was established to bar Apple and Alphabet Inc’s Google from featuring new TikTok downloads.

China’s ByteDance, which owns TikTok, has been under pressure to sell the common application.

The White Dwelling contends that TikTok poses nationwide safety fears as personalized details collected on a hundred million People who use the application could be acquired by China’s government.

Any deal will also however have to have to be reviewed by the US government’s Committee on International Expenditure in the United States.

Negotiations are under way for Walmart and Oracle to just take stakes in a new company, TikTok International, that would oversee US operations.

But essential phrases of the deal – together with who will have majority possession – are in dispute. ByteDance has also mentioned any deal will have to have to be permitted by China.

Beijing has revised its checklist of systems issue to export bans in a way that presents it a say above any TikTok deal.
